HD wallpaper: Fresh fruit, lime, green lemon, leaves free download

Current photo size: 2880 x 1800 px • Resolution:2K
Fresh fruit, lime, green lemon, leaves
Fresh fruit, lime, green lemon, leaves
Fresh fruit, lime, green lemon, leaves